Shatana Slams McBrown, Gifty Adorye And Others For Undergoing Liposuction

Published

on

Ghanaian songstress and activist, Ranaya Pappoe, popularly known in the showbiz circles as Shatana has fired figurative missiles at some celebrities who have undergone various body enhancement procedures of which liposuction is keen.

In an interview on TV Africa, Shatana protested that the decision of the celebrities who have undergone liposuction is untenable and must be condemned by right thinking members of the society.

Shatana who has received wide commendations for positive and natural body advocates singled out Nana McBrown and Gifty Adorye for criticism.

She held that the conduct of these entertainment personalities is an affront to the ethics and norms of the Ghanaian culture and must be condemned.

She raised concerns about the risky nature of the liposuction process and insisted that McBrown and her ilks are not serving as good examples for the youth.

She urged the Ghanaian youth not to follow their path and rather use natural means to improve their body shape.

“Moesha started the liposuction business and the likes of Gifty Adorye and Nana McBrown joined. It’s like a long roll call and they don’t want us to talk about it because they are celebs. Why don’t they want us to talk about it.”

“I respect the elderly but the liposuction is bad and their actions are instigating the young ones to follow that path. People died in Nigeria. In Ghana, we know the story of the woman who died at Obengfo so what are they teaching the youth”, she retorted.

“What moral lessons are they teaching the youth. Per the definition of celebrities, none of them fits that description, by living that fake kind of life. Smoking and drinking and influencing the youth badly. It is evil,” she said.

Mc Desaint Lits Up “Abeka Salla Fest 2024”

Published

on

By

Award winning master of ceremony, Mc Desaint puts up a world class show at this year’s “Abeka Salla Fest 2024”. The show which was organized by Hon. Baba Sadiq, the NDC parliamentary candidate for Okaikwei Central, sponsored by blue jeans energy drink, indomie, gig energy, among others.

The show which was held on the streets of Abeka got the whole country buzzing. Mc Desaint with his high energy and agility pumped up the audience with excitement and steered the affairs of the show with professional mastery over the microphone.

Artistes on the bill of the show were Dopenation, Olivetheboy, Larruso,  King Promise, Wendy Shay, Jupitar, Chief One, et al with Shatta Wale as headline artiste.
